Local Laws

Local Law Number of the year Filed on Subject
4 2024 Dec 20, 2024 A local law to allow tax bill insertions.
3 2024 Nov 26, 2024 A local law to override the tax levy limit established in General Municipal Law section 3-c for Fiscal Year 2025.
2 2024 May 21, 2024 A local law to supersede Local Law number 1 of 1995 and returning Grievance Day to the fourth Tuesday of May.
1 2024 Feb 23, 2024 A local law to authorize a real property tax exemption for volunteer firefighters and volunteer ambulance workers pursuant to Real Property Tax Law section 466-a.
1 2022 Nov 28, 2022 A local law to override the tax levy limit established in General Municipal Law section 3-c.
3 2021 Jul 12, 2021 A local law to opt out of allowing cannabis retail dispensaries and on-site consumption sites as authorized under Article 4 of Cannabis Law.
2 2021 May 10, 2021 A local law granting partial property tax exemption to certain seniors and persons with disabilities; setting income limits for the same; and repealing Local Law number 1 of 1999 and resolution of January 8, 2007 and local law number 1 of 2021.
1 2021 Mar 04, 2021 A local law granting partial property tax exemption to certain seniors and persons with disabilities; setting income limits for the same; and repealing Local Law number 1 of 1999 and resolution of January 8, 2007.
1 2020 Feb 20, 2020 A local law regulating parking of vehicles on Town streets, roads, and highways during winter months and during times of public highway emergencies.
2 2019 Jul 31, 2019 A local law to amend the Land Management Ordinance to address towers and other structures over 35 feet in height, pursuant to Town Law section 130.
1 2019 Apr 05, 2019 A local law to amend the Land Management Ordinance to address electricity production systems, pursuant to Town Law section 130.
1 2018 Apr 16, 2018 A local law to amend the Town of Covert Land Management Ordinance; adopted pursuant to Town Law section 130.
2 2017 Aug 23, 2017 A local law allowing common, safe items to be excluded from the dangerous fireworks definition as permitted by New York State Penal Law ection 405(b).
1 2017 Aug 23, 2017 A local law imposing a temporary one year moratorium on approvals for solar energy facilities, wind energy facilities, and cellular communications towers.
1 2010 Dec 10, 2010 A local law dog control law.
2 2009 Jan 22, 2010 A local law providing for the alternative veterans' exemption from the real property taxation.
1 2009 Jul 13, 2009 A local law establishing "Right to Farm".
2 2004 Nov 2, 2004 A local law allowing bingo in the Town of Covert.
1 2004 May 24, 2004 A local law to increase the salary of Town Justice Elizabeth D. Raymond.
1 2003 Dec 15, 2003 A local law providing a four-year term for the elective office of the Town Clerk of the Town of Covert.
2 2003 Dec 15, 2003 A local law providing a four-year term for the elective office of the Town Superintendent of Highways of the Town of Covert.
1 2001 Feb 22, 2001 A local law to regulate adult entertainment facilities.
1 1999 Dec 03, 1999 A local law providing partial exemption from real property taxes for people with disabilities and limited income.
2 1996 Nov 06, 1996 A local law authorizing games of chance by authorized organizations.
1 1987 Mar 31, 1987 A local law to promote the public health, safety, and general welfare, and to minimize public and private losses due to flood conditions in specific areas.
1 1983 Jun 27, 1983 A local law stating the Town of Covert will not enforce the Uniform Fire and Building Code.
1 1979 Jul 09, 1979 A local law prohibit dumping of garbage and or refuse originating outside the Town.

Local Laws are filed with the New York Department of State.
